Cashion and Hennessey are places in Oklahoma.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Hennessey has the higher population (2,603 vs 1,311 in Cashion). Cashion has the higher median household income ($93,808 vs $54,185 in Hennessey). Cashion has the higher median home value ($189,600 vs $165,900 in Hennessey).
